Considerations When Choosing a Large Top Entry Litter Box
Choosing a large top entry litter box requires careful thought. Some factors can greatly enhance the experience for both the cat and me.
Size and Dimensions
Size matters when picking a litter box. I’ve found that a spacious box gives my Ragdoll, Milo, plenty of room to move around. A box measuring at least 30 inches long and 20 inches wide works well for larger cats. According to studies, 68% of cats prefer boxes larger than the standard size, promoting comfort and confidence when they do their business.
